BreakTypes enumeration
Options for selecting one of the pages adjacent to the current one.
The BreakTypes enumeration has the following constants of type int.
BREAK_CHARACTER = 0
Breaks the string at each character boundary.
BREAK_WORD = 1
Breaks the string at each word boundary.
BREAK_LINE = 1
Breaks the string at each point it would be appropriate to wrap a line.
BREAK_SENTENCE = 1
Breaks the string at each sentence boundary.

break method
Breaks the string into constituent parts. Note that this uses rules specified by Unicode TR29, so might find different boundaries to LD's formatting engine.

compare method
Compares two strings in this locale.
